1984 Audi 90 vs. 1971 Fiat 500

To start off, 1984 Audi 90 is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1971 Fiat 500.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1971 Fiat 500 would be higher. At 2,226 cc (5 cylinders), 1984 Audi 90 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1984 Audi 90 (139 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 121 more horse power than 1971 Fiat 500. (18 HP @ 4600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1984 Audi 90 should accelerate faster than 1971 Fiat 500.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1984 Audi 90 weights approximately 750 kg more than 1971 Fiat 500.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1984 Audi 90 (190 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 163 more torque (in Nm) than 1971 Fiat 500. (27 Nm @ 3200 RPM). This means 1984 Audi 90 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1971 Fiat 500.
